Why Visit Esen, Belgium?#

Located in Flanders near the Belgian coast, Esen is a small rural hub that suits cyclists and food-minded visitors. The area’s quiet lanes are popular for bike tours between market towns and coastal resorts like De Panne, while local brasseries serve regional dishes such as moules-frites and farmhouse cheeses. Village events and seasonal markets provide a glimpse of Flemish traditions, and short drives connect visitors to broader West Flanders history and shoreline scenery.

Day Trips

Diksmuide First World War sites - Historic trenches, museums, and memorials commemorating the Yser battles within easy driving distance.

West Flanders coastal towns - Beaches and seaside promenades of Koksijde and Nieuwpoort reachable within forty minutes’ drive.

Best Time to Visit Esen, Belgium#

Esen sits in Belgium’s maritime climate: mild summers, cool damp winters. Visit between late spring and early autumn for the nicest weather and longest daylight.

Winter

December - February

-2°C to 7°C (28°F to 45°F)

Cool and damp winters - manageable for city visits but bring warm, waterproof layers.

Spring & Autumn

March - May & September - November

5°C to 18°C (41°F to 64°F)

Fresh, changeable weather perfect for walks and local markets; light rain is common but not constant.

Summer

June - August

15°C to 25°C (59°F to 77°F)

Pleasant, mild summers great for outdoor dining and nearby coastal trips; rarely very hot.

Climate

Esen, Belgium's climate is classified as Oceanic - Oceanic climate with mild summers (peaking in August) and cold winters (coldest in January). Temperatures range from 1°C to 22°C. Moderate rainfall (729 mm/year).

Where to Stay in Esen, Belgium#

Budget

Esen / Diksmuide - $50-90/night

Esen is a small village (Diksmuide area) with a few B&Bs and limited cheap hotel options; most budget travellers stay in nearby Diksmuide.

Shopping in Esen, Belgium#

Shopping choices are limited to local retailers and convenience stores. For more variety or specialist shops, travel to nearby urban centres in West Flanders.

Nightlife in Esen, Belgium#

Nightlife is modest - a few cafés and local pubs operate in the evenings, but there are no clubs or extensive late-night options.
